Migraines, irritable bowel syndrome, essential hypertension, chronic pain, insomnia, post tra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), anxiety, depression, excessive fatigue are just a few of the ongoing complaints of domestic violence survivors. And it’s not surprising.

These conditions are ALL mediated by the sympathetic nervous systema system perpetually “on” for individuals whose lives are entangled in domestic abuse.

Stemming back to our caveman ancestors, we inherited a physiology that is built to protect us from the perceived threat of impending danger. And when present, sympathetic arousal occurs.

For example, when the caveman saw a tiger, the thought “tiger” registered, activating a limbic system response of FEAR…ultimately, resulting in an adrenergic response that prepares the body for “fight or flight.” And with this, of course, mobilizing the proper body systems to deal with the circumstances at hand.

The Good: Our Survival Mechanism

Here’s what happens: blood rushes to the core of the body and away from the periphery, fueling the core organs, (heart and lungs) for this magnificent maneuver. Blood is quickly pumped into the large muscle groups to enable your rapid exit or fierce fight.

With this, many other physiological changes occur. You’re getting the picture, correct? In a nutshell…

1) Your cardiovascular system is aroused: increased heart rate, rise in blood pressure.

2) Your neuromuscular system is activated: increased muscle tension, and

3) Your gastrointestinal system shuts off: dry mouth, build up of acidity in the gut, bowel and bladder relax.

This is sympathetic arousal; that is the activation of the sympathetic nervous system. It is our body’s response to impending danger. It’s your survival mechanism, your natural stress response. This is good.

The Bad: Failure to Cycle Down

However, here’s where it’s not good. In the same way that our bodies are built to trigger this response, so are we built to cycle down when the impeding danger or perceived threat passes. And since our physiological systems don’t know the difference between real and perceived threat, we have the ability to keep this stress response “on” such that complete cycling down fails to occur.

Then when the next tiger comes our way, naturally we are appropriately aroused. But this time the excitation starts from an already elevated point of arousal, thereby resulting in a higher-level stress response.

Now for a moment, let’s envision our creating a habit, if you will, of not fully cycling down between each perceived threat; that is, between each tiger crossing our path. What happens?

Your body systems, associated with the stress response, remain “on” and at higher and higher levels of arousal over time with subsequent activation. This is what we call “chronic stress.”

The Ugly: Stress-Related Illnesses

Here’s the danger. When you keep these organ systems functioning as such, eventually they show symptoms of excess activation. This is the basic etiology of stress-related illnesses: migraine headaches, muscle contraction headaches, irritable bowel syndrome, essential hypertension, insomnia, chronic anxiety…and the list goes on.

Further, you can expect chronic stress to exacerbate depression, anxiety, cognitive impairment and more. It is the one factor you can count on to aggravate emotional psychological distress.

Your know how it is when you are refreshed and calm: anxiety, depression and cognitive impairment are low. And when you’re excessively stressed, anxiety, depression and cognitive impairment are magnified many fold.

If you are a domestic violence survivor, seek to cultivate habits that turn “off” the stress response. This will off-set damage done by a pattern naturally inherent in a current or past life of constant criticism, unpredictable partner rage, and ongoing caution, trepidation and fear.

When divorce and domestic violence are before the court, the children can often serve as the vehicle for the perpetrator to save face and maintain control over the family. Sound familiar?

If you are in family court with an abusive partner, or abusive ex-partner, and there are children involved, you will want to know what this article reveals. Here is how your children can be leveraged to carry out a perpetrator’s agenda in family court.

Laying the Foundation to Maintain Control over the Family

Let’s say the perpetrator establishes that he wants to ask the court for sole custody of your minor children whom he has also abused, either directly or indirectly. In many cases this so-called asking may happen even if the perpetrator is not a candidate for custody.

Now once the pleading is before the court, and typically for a long time (could be years), the chase is on—even though a so-called custody battle is technically not underway.

What is underway is a mission to create a scenario to establish that the perpetrator (whether or not a candidate for custody by law) is indeed an eligible person for custody because:

a) this parent is the only parent left b) the other parent is crazy or is a felon c) this parent is a victim of parental alienation syndrome …or, any combination of the above.

Most typically, we see counsel seeking to establish items b & c in combination, as this makes for a more substantial case. And further, this strategy is often a best first measure to carry out a perpetrator’s mission of eliminating the protective parent from their children’s lives.

Crazing Making Legal Psychiatric Ploys

Now if after psychiatric evaluations, there is no evidence that the mother (the gender most often in this position) is “crazy” because the evaluating psychiatrist cannot—or will not—find any psychiatric pathology, then the rush is on to find—or create—”the craziness” in the children.

The strategy here is that if we can’t show that the mother is crazy, we’ll establish that the children are either crazy or going crazy under her care. This is how children become casualties in an abuser’s use of the court to control and batter their victims.

Now making a child crazy can take days, months or years. And if there are two or more children involved, making more than one child psychologically unstable makes for even a stronger case, even if you are the recognized psychological parent of your children.

If you have witnessed this legal psychiatric ploy in your divorce proceeding or a glimpse of it coming, learn to block it and protect your children and yourself before the ploy spirals out of control.
